This Boiler Safety Connection Group is an integrated safety assembly designed for small boilers and heating systems. It combines an expansion tank, pressure gauge, safety valve, and air vent into a single compact unit, all mounted on a stainless steel bracket. This all-in-one design enables the simultaneous realization of four key safety functions. Real-time pressure monitoring, overpressure relief protection, automatic air venting, and pressure buffering. helping keep boiler and heating systems running safely and steadily.

This 304 stainless steel air vent valve is an automatic air release component. It’s made for fluid piping systems. It works with a float-driven mechanism. When air builds up in the pipeline, the float drops. The air release port opens automatically to release the trapped gas. Once all the air is gone, the float rises. It seals the port tightly to stop water leakage. A built-in manual knob also allows manual opening of the air release port, enhancing system maintenance or manual venting flexibility.

Air Admittance Valve
This air admittance valve is a pressure-balancing part for indoor drain systems. When draining, it automatically lets air into the pipe to balance the inner pressure. This prevents the water seal from being damaged and keeps foul sewer gas from flowing back into living areas. The valve has union connections on both ends and can connect directly to PVC drain pipes. It’s ideal for use in bathrooms and kitchens.

Brass Swing Check Valve
This brass swing check valve features a straight-through, horizontal body. It’s a one-way part for fluid pipe systems, keeping flow going in just one direction. The swing valve core opens by itself when forward fluid pressure pushes it. It shuts right away if the flow reverses. This stops the media from flowing back and protects the pipe equipment to keep it running steadily. It’s a great fit for many uses: water pump discharge lines, water supply and drainage systems in high-rise buildings, and HVAC circulation systems.

FAQs of Boiler Safety Connection Group
1. What material is the boiler safety connection group’s insulation shell?
We use EPP for the protective shell material. It costs a bit more than the common EPS white foam on the market, but it has clear advantages for actual use and transportation safety. The key differences are in four main aspects:
High toughness, strong resilience EPS is brittle. It easily cracks and crumbles under pressure or impact, leading to transport damage and customer complaints. EPP has great elasticity and resilience. Even with strong impact or extrusion, it quickly bounces back to its original shape with almost no damage.
Stable performance at high temperatures EPS softens and deforms when the temperature exceeds 70 ℃. It can also age and turn brittle after long use in the high-temperature environment of a boiler room. EPP maintains its structure and insulation performance over the temperature range from -40 ℃ to 110 ℃. It’s a perfect fit for high-temperature scenarios like boiler rooms.
Better appearance and texture EPS has a rough, grainy surface, looking cheap overall. EPP has a smooth surface and dense structure, with a cleaner look and a stronger sense of quality. It’s more in line with the positioning of mid- to high-end products.
Eco-friendly and recyclable EPP is an environmentally friendly material. It’s 100% recyclable. This is a significant advantage in markets with strict environmental regulations, such as Europe and Australia.
2. How to ensure thread precision and consistency in the boiler safety connection group?
Plumberstar uses CNC lathes for thread machining. For different thread standards and specifications, such as BSP and NPT, we’ve created standardized CNC machining programs. These programs have been tested and verified many times. Operators can call them up directly. This avoids deviations and errors from manual programming.
Before each formal production run, we make a first sample. We send it to the quality control lab right away. We perform 3D full-size inspections with CMMs and profile projectors. We check all key parameters comprehensively—like pitch, tooth angle, and tooth depth. We make sure everything fully meets the design drawing requirements. Only after the first sample is confirmed qualified, we’ll start mass production.
During mass production, QA personnel with over 10 years of experience monitor quality nonstop. They conduct random inspections at a fixed frequency: for every 100 products made, they use professional thread-go/no-go gauges to check. This ensures thread accuracy and consistency across the entire batch of products.
